How to fill out calendaring for criminal cases

How to fill out calendaring for criminal cases:
01
Understand the relevant laws and regulations: Familiarize yourself with the criminal laws and regulations in your jurisdiction to ensure you have a clear understanding of the requirements for calendaring criminal cases.
02
Gather necessary information: Gather all the pertinent information related to the criminal case, including the defendant's name, charges, case number, court dates, and any other relevant details. This information will be crucial for accurately filling out the calendar.
03
Use a reliable calendaring system: Choose a reliable calendaring system that suits your needs, whether it's a digital calendar or a physical planner. Make sure it allows you to input all the necessary information and provides reminders for upcoming court dates.
04
Assign appropriate reminders: Set reminders for important deadlines and court dates, ensuring that you are well-prepared for each stage of the criminal case. This will help you stay organized and prevent any last-minute surprises.
05
Double-check accuracy: Before finalizing the calendar, double-check all the entered information for accuracy. Any mistakes or omissions could result in missed deadlines or court appearances, which can have serious consequences for the case.
Who needs calendaring for criminal cases:
01
Attorneys: Criminal defense attorneys require calendaring for criminal cases to ensure they are well-prepared for court dates, deadlines, and other important milestones in the legal process. It helps them stay organized and provide effective representation to their clients.
02
Prosecutors: Prosecutors also rely on calendaring for criminal cases to manage their workload effectively and ensure they meet all necessary obligations. It allows them to track court dates, witness availability, and other crucial information.
03
Court clerks: Court clerks use calendaring for criminal cases to manage the court's schedule efficiently. They schedule hearings, track case statuses, and ensure that the court proceedings run smoothly.
04
Judges: Judges benefit from calendaring for criminal cases to manage their docket and schedule hearings, trials, and other court proceedings. It helps them allocate appropriate time for each case and maintain an organized courtroom.
05
Defendants and witnesses: Defendants and witnesses involved in criminal cases may also benefit from having access to the calendar. It allows them to stay informed about their upcoming court appearances and make necessary arrangements.
Calendaring for criminal cases is essential for all relevant parties involved to ensure the legal process runs smoothly and efficiently.

What is calendaring for criminal cases?
Calendaring for criminal cases is the process of scheduling court dates and deadlines related to a criminal case.
Who is required to file calendaring for criminal cases?
The prosecuting attorney or the defense attorney is typically responsible for filing calendaring for criminal cases.
How to fill out calendaring for criminal cases?
Calendaring for criminal cases is typically filled out using a court-specific form or electronic system provided by the court.
What is the purpose of calendaring for criminal cases?
The purpose of calendaring for criminal cases is to ensure that all parties involved in the case are aware of important dates and deadlines.
What information must be reported on calendaring for criminal cases?
Calendaring for criminal cases typically includes the date and time of court hearings, deadlines for filing motions, and other important case-related events.
